| | A newly discovered part that may be useful to trainheads, et al
|
|
While breaking down some sets from a recent clearance run, I came across an interesting new part... 42607. It looks like a wing 12 x 6 with notched corners, but it has the distinction of having a technic brick (2 x 4) molded into the inboard end. (...)
